N-Propyl-p-toluenesulfonamide

Description:
N-Propyl-p-toluenesulfonamide, with the CAS number 1133-12-6, is an organic compound characterized by its sulfonamide functional group attached to a p-toluenesulfonyl moiety. This compound typically appears as a white to off-white solid and is soluble in organic solvents, reflecting its hydrophobic nature due to the presence of the propyl and toluene groups. It is often utilized in various chemical applications, including as an intermediate in organic synthesis and in the development of pharmaceuticals. The sulfonamide group imparts specific chemical properties, such as the ability to form hydrogen bonds, which can influence its reactivity and interactions with biological systems. Additionally, N-propyl-p-toluenesulfonamide may exhibit antimicrobial properties, making it of interest in medicinal chemistry. Safety data indicates that, like many sulfonamides, it should be handled with care, as it may cause irritation or allergic reactions in sensitive individuals. Overall, its unique structure and properties make it a valuable compound in both industrial and research settings.
Formula:C10H15NO2S
InChI:InChI=1/C10H15NO2S/c1-3-8-11-14(12,13)10-6-4-9(2)5-7-10/h4-7,11H,3,8H2,1-2H3
InChI key:InChIKey=FGTLUYQJKVPUHM-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:S(NCCC)(=O)(=O)C1=CC=C(C)C=C1
